Dung Beetle guide

The Dung Beetle is an omnivore in ARK: Survival Ascended. It spawns wild on The Island, Scorched Earth, Aberration and Extinction. This page covers its spawn commands, base stats, taming and breeding — with interactive calculators you can drive by level.

How to tame the Dung Beetle

The Dung Beetle is a passive tame — no knockout needed. Approach it carefully without weapons drawn and feed it both meat and berries — with its preferred kibble taming fastest and at higher effectiveness from your last inventory slot, waiting for the feeding cooldown between each. Staying out of its line of sight and avoiding sudden moves stops it fleeing or turning hostile.
